The Arabia CSR Network has officially launched the sixth cycle of the Arabia CSR Awards 2013.
Held under the patronage of HH Sheikh Ahmed Bin Saeed Al Maktoum, President of Dubai Civil Aviation Authority; Chairman and CEO of Emirates Group; & Chairman, Dubai Airports and supported by the United Nations Global Compact, the Arabia CSR Award is the most prestigious and highly coveted CSR Award in the Arab world.
The Arabia CSR Awards is a home-grown product of the Middle East and North Africa region. It aims to highlight CSR best practices and showcase the sustainability achievements of public and private sector companies.
In the past five cycles of the Awards, the ACSRN has received close to 400 applications from 13 countries in the Arab world. To see the winners from last year's cycle, please visit this page.

The six categories of the Arabia CSR Awards 2013 are:
- Small-sized enterprises
- Medium-sized enterprises
- Large-sized enterprises
- Government authorities / departments
- Corporate-NGO collaboration
- New business
